Sharing data between jsp's

how can i share different variable difined in one jsp to another jsp??
thanks!!!!

Are the two JSPs on the same user request? Use the request object to store the variables?
Are the two JSPs read by the same user but on different requests? Use the session object.
Are the two JSPs read by different users? Put the data in the application object.
Not sure how to use the pageContext, request, session, and application objects? Read chapters 11-16 of the J2EE tutorial: http://java.sun.com/j2ee/1.4/docs/tutorial/doc/index.html

    Hello N K,
    sorry thats not possible. Sharing a data item / object instance requires at least a common physical memory. As this is not guaranteed between different app. server this is technical not possible.
    With release 640 ABAP offers the new feature Shared Objects. These mechanism allows access by different users and some propagation to differnt servers.There is an interesting article on the ABAP SDN homepage
    https://www.sdn.sap.com/sdn/developerareas/abap.sdn
    For relases below more or less the database is the only chance to store data accross application servers (known to me). One exception might be the ENQUEUES which might (mis)used to store some Flags.

    Two different things. The encoding adds this to the URL (after the page, before the query string
    ;jsessionid=ABC123 but only if the user isn't using cookies.
    So in your example, you would do this (maybe):
    <%
      String url = response.encodeURL("Servlet");
    %>
      <form name="form1" method="post" action="<%= url %>?cmd=pay"> ... Or some modification.
    So the difference between encodeing and using a post is that
    1) encoding adds the jsessionid to the url string if necessary. It does nothing else
    2) POSTing will send a request to the provided URL via the POST method, including the inputs of the form as parameters to the URL.
    They really don't interact with each other. It is like asking what is the difference between the Color Orange and thr Size Big? They can both be applied to the same thing, or not... and have no real relation to each other.

  • How can share data between jsp pages using beans??

    any one can give me code for 2 jsp pages with bean that share data for them

    <jsp:usebean name="yourBeanName" type="com.whatever.foo" scope="session"/>
    this will look for a bean named yourBeanName in the scope specified by the scope attribute. If none was found, the container will instantiate one with the no arg constructor for your bean and place it into the proper scope.
    if your bean had a method getName(), you could then on your jsp do:
    <%=yourBeanName.getName()%> to print the results of the method to the page. there are other ways to do the actual placing of the output on the page, but this is the most direct.

    Greg Campbell wrote:
    Hi Wolfgang,
    Are you using Kodo's Datastore cache in both web apps? I suspect that what
    is happening is that the data actually is being flushed to the database
    appropriately (assuming that you commit your transactions), but that your
    cache in your second app has stale data. Could you turn off the datastore
    cache in both apps just test that hypothesis?
    If your applications start to work as expected with the datacache off, then
    you should check out (assuming you're using Kodo v. 3.1.3)
    http://www.solarmetric.com/Software/Documentation/3.1.3/docs/ref_guide_event.html#ref_guide_event_conf
    That section of doc describes how to get the datastore caches in the two
    JVMs talking to each other.
